单通道归零差分相移键控传输系统中的非线性相位噪声分析

Analysis of nonlinear phase noise in single-channel return-to-zero differential phase-shift keying transmission systems.

作者信息

Zhang Fan, Bunge Christian-A, Petermann Klaus

机构信息

Fachgebiet Hochfrequenztechnik, Technische Universität Berlin, D-10587 Berlin, Germany.

出版信息

Opt Lett. 2006 Apr 15;31(8):1038-40. doi: 10.1364/ol.31.001038.

DOI:10.1364/ol.31.001038
PMID:16625895
Abstract

Self-phase modulation and intrachannel cross-phase-modulation- (IXPM) induced nonlinear phase noise is investigated by the variational method. IXPM can cause a considerable increase of phase noise. We show, however, that IXPM leads to a partial correlation between the phase noises of adjacent pulses, which tends to reduce the influence of nonlinear phase noise in return-to-zero differential phase-shift keying transmission. In highly dispersive transmission systems, intrachannel four-wave mixing-induced differential phase fluctuations are typically larger than differential nonlinear phase noise. The analysis is validated by Monte Carlo simulation.
